What: Following Armenian tradition, Vartivar is a festival where young and old drench each other with water, and Batchig is honoring tradition with a Vartivar brunch at the garden this weekend. An open buffet of delicious Armenian food is exactly how one should spend their Saturday morning!

9. Palm Islands (Jazirit Al Aranib) with Adventures in Lebanon
What: Based on people’s demand for water activities during the scorching summer heat, Adventures in Lebanon is hosting a trip to the Palm Islands in Tripoli. This fun trip will include a boat trip, guided island visits to Al-Bakkar, Al-Nakhl, Al-Billan, Al-Ramkin, Sananee, Al-Rmayleh, Al-Ashak, Al-Telteh, and Al-Rabha islands, and finally a barbecue and drinks to end the day.
